    This Michaels store is a five-minute drive from where I am staying. It's in Eagan Promenade, next door to OfficeMax. I checked this store out after shopping at OfficeMax. There is plenty of parking at this plaza. I did a lot of browsing. The clearance items are down a corridor when you first walk through the doors. There were some great post-Christmas deals, including Funko Pop figurines and jewelry-making kits. My favourite area is the calligraphy aisle. I managed to find a felt-tipped calligraphy pen that was just over $2. I decided to get it. This section is pretty good compared to most Michaels that I have frequented. The tie-dye aisle stands out. I have never seen such an extensive selection of paint, kits, and t-shirts. If you are into tie-dying everything, you may want to check out this store. The only downside was not seeing a whole lot of staff members helping folks out. I didn't need any, but I did see a couple of customers trying to flag staff members with no luck. I paid for my item with a credit card. The woman was competent, but wasn't exactly warm. Maybe that's simply who she is. It's a decent store. My calligraphy pen works well. No complaints here. (6)
